How does an e-wallet payment system contribute to the security of digital currency transactions?

    An e-wallet payment system contributes to the security of digital currency transactions by providing a secure storage solution for users' private keys. With an e-wallet, users can securely store their private keys offline, reducing the risk of them being compromised by hackers. Additionally, e-wallets often employ encryption techniques to protect sensitive information, such as transaction details and user identities. This helps to prevent unauthorized access and ensures that transactions are conducted securely.

    Using an e-wallet payment system adds an extra layer of security to digital currency transactions. By storing private keys offline, e-wallets make it much more difficult for hackers to gain access to users' funds. Furthermore, many e-wallets require multi-factor authentication, such as biometric verification or two-factor authentication, to ensure that only authorized individuals can access the wallet. These security measures greatly reduce the risk of unauthorized transactions and protect users' digital assets.
